Four, including two children, dead in fatal car-lorry collision in Gua Musang
At about 9am, a Honda EK sedan carrying five occupants collided head-on with a lorry, resulting in all car passengers being trapped in the wreckage - August 11, 2025

The incident occurred at approximately 9am, involving a Honda EK sedan carrying five occupants, which collided head-on with a lorry, resulting in all car passengers being trapped in the wreckage. The lorry driver was unharmed.

Commander of the Gua Musang Fire and Rescue Station (BBP), PBK II Nik Mohd Fakri Md Nawi, stated that emergency services were alerted through the MERS system and dispatched to the scene, 34 kilometres away.

"Upon arrival at 9.34am, it was found that five victims were trapped inside the car," he said in a statement on Sunday.

"A man, a woman, and two children were confirmed dead at the scene, while a woman who was driving the car was in critical condition."

The injured victim was transported to hospital for emergency treatment. The deceased have been handed over to police for further action.

The operation involved nine personnel from the Gua Musang BBP, supported by a Fire Rescue Tender, an Emergency Medical Rescue Services (EMRS) vehicle, and a First Response Vehicle (Mitsubishi Triton). - August 11, 2025
